連動しておりません。また、それぞれ設定内容が異なります。
- アプリの「お知らせを受信する」チェックを外すと、プッシュ配信を受信いたしません。(サーバーから配信しません)ポップアップは出ず、通知にも入りません。アプリのお知らせ一覧にも入りません。
- 「コンテンツのみ配信」機能ご利用の場合は「お知らせを受信する」がオフでも、お知らせ一覧(コンテンツ一覧)には表示されます。
- OS の「通知を表示」
チェックをはずすと、「通知」に入りません。ポップアップ(ダイアログ実装時)は表示され、アプリのお知らせ一覧にも表示されます。
1. お知らせ設定画面
Android SDK は iOS と異なり、2. の端末設定と別で設定画面を用意する必要があります。
FANSHIP 設定画面
src/PopinfoSettings.java
res/layout/popinfo_settings.xml
上記設定画面を利用しない場合は、以下を参考に、ユーザーがお知らせ許諾を制御できるよう実装してください。
SDKに同梱されている以下ファイルをご確認ください。
/popinfo-sdk-android-X.X.X/popinfo_javadoc/index.html
左ナビの「PopinfoSettingUtils」の中に
FANSHIPの設定を操作するためのクラス一覧があります。
「isPushEnabled」を参照してください。
---(以下抜粋)------------------
isPushEnabled
public static boolean isPushEnabled(android.content.Context context)
「お知らせを受信する」の設定値を取得します。(PUSH通知の有効/無効)
パラメータ:context - コンテキスト
戻り値:true(有効) or false(無効)
---------------------------------------
2. OSのアプリ情報の「通知を表示」
端末側の設定となり、FANSHIP の許諾オンオフとはリンクしておりません。